Executive summary
The report presented facts and ideas about the management of leadership based on the
context of a family owned business named Sekar Group. Susilo used to manage the business
but soon it was time for him to hand over the responsibilities to his family members, i.e., the
new generation members who could be the successor to him. It was found that the major
issues were associated with the poor knowledge and skills about the corporate environment
among the new generation members, which might create complexities for the organisation to
survive in the competitive business environment. To focus on the issues related to
sustainability, CSR and other related issues, Welly should be the right choice as he had
acquired a Bachelor degree and even worked as a marketing manager, which could be
suitable for managing the business and guide the team members in the right direction too.
Based on the recommendations, it could be assessed that focus on sustainable measures and
for promoting leadership programs and employee training should make the members capable
of adjusting to the change in culture and organisational functioning, furthermore allow the
manager to keep them motivated and interested to perform to their potential as well.

Background of the company
Harry Susilo Private Ltd is a major business organisation that used to manage various
business divisions and it started its operations with just five employees and at present, it has
been renamed as Sekar Group, which consists of more than 20000 employees and is
considered as a major company on the Jakarta Stock Exchange. The organisation has been
specialised in various sections including food, agriculture, mineral products as well as real
